diff --git a/src/components/floor-plan/CanvasFrame.jsx b/src/components/floor-plan/CanvasFrame.jsx
index 6a48d83b..6e812930 100644
--- a/src/components/floor-plan/CanvasFrame.jsx
+++ b/src/components/floor-plan/CanvasFrame.jsx
@@ -13,6 +13,7 @@ import QContextMenu from '@/components/common/context-menu/QContextMenu'
import { useCanvasConfigInitialize } from '@/hooks/common/useCanvasConfigInitialize'
import { MENU } from '@/common/common'
import PanelBatchStatistics from '@/components/floor-plan/modal/panelBatch/PanelBatchStatistics'
+import { totalDisplaySelector } from '@/store/settingAtom'
export default function CanvasFrame() {
const canvasRef = useRef(null)
@@ -21,6 +22,7 @@ export default function CanvasFrame() {
const currentMenu = useRecoilValue(currentMenuState)
const { contextMenu, handleClick } = useContextMenu()
const { selectedPlan, modifiedPlanFlag, checkCanvasObjectEvent, resetModifiedPlans, currentCanvasPlan } = usePlan()
+ const totalDisplay = useRecoilValue(totalDisplaySelector) // 집계표 표시 여부
useEvent()
const loadCanvas = () => {
@@ -72,7 +74,8 @@ export default function CanvasFrame() {
MENU.MODULE_CIRCUIT_SETTING.BASIC_SETTING,
MENU.MODULE_CIRCUIT_SETTING.CIRCUIT_TRESTLE_SETTING,
MENU.MODULE_CIRCUIT_SETTING.PLAN_ORIENTATION,
- ].includes(currentMenu) && }
+ ].includes(currentMenu) &&
+ totalDisplay && }
)
}